Donald Earl Merchant, child of God, loving husband, father and friend passed away peacefully on Tuesday, May 17, 2022. He was a lifelong resident of Pensacola. Don loved his Savior, Jesus Christ, his wife, children, family and his church.

Born in Seminole, A L in 1934, Don moved with his family to Pensacola when he was six years old. He attended local schools and graduated from Pensacola High School in 1953. He worked at Pensacola Hardware, where he met his bride-to-be.

Don proudly served his country in the U.S. Army, where he was a sergeant at Fort Bragg, NC. He participated in the atomic testing at Desert Rock, NV, in 1957. Following his service he returned to Pensacola, where he worked for Gulf Power Company for 38 years, the last 14 of which was in the current theft division. He loved hosting fish fries, casting the net for mullet, and fishing, crabbing and scalloping from his boat in Pensacola Bay. You would find him there just about every Saturday morning, before the crack of dawn, often with his children. When Don retired from Gulf Power in 1996, he volunteered as financial administrator for Immanuel Lutheran Church for the next 21 years. He shared his love of all kinds of music with people and sang bass in the church choir since 1958.

Don was loved by many and will be missed by all who knew him. He is preceded in death by his son, Ronald Kirk Merchant ; his sister, Dottie Gilmore; his mom and dad, Mr. and Mrs. James Merchant ("Bama" and "Bud") .

Those left to cherish his memory includ e his loving wife of 66 years, Jan E. Merchant; a son, Rusty Merchant; a daughter, Melanie J. Haveard (Mike) ; many grandchildren, nieces, nephews, cousins , grand-nieces and grand-nephews also survive.
